Mobile agent-enabled framework for structuring and building distributed systems on the internet

来源 :Science in China(Series F:Information Sciences) | 被引量 : 0次 | 上传用户:fang82888
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
Mobile agent has shown its promise as a powerful means to complement and enhance existing technology in various application areas. In particular, existing work has demonstrated that MA can simplify the development and improve the performance of certain classes of distributed applications, especially for those running on a wide-area, heterogeneous, and dynamic networking environment like the Internet. In our previous work, we extended the application of MA to the design of distributed control functions, which require the maintenance of logical relationship among and/or coordination of proc- essing entities in a distributed system. A novel framework is presented for structuring and building distributed systems, which use cooperating mobile agents as an aid to carry out coordination and cooperation tasks in distributed systems. The framework has been used for designing various distributed control functions such as load balancing and mutual ex- clusion in our previous work. In this paper, we use the framework to propose a novel ap- proach to detecting deadlocks in distributed system by using mobile agents, which dem- onstrates the advantage of being adaptive and flexible of mobile agents. We first describe the MAEDD (Mobile Agent Enabled Deadlock Detection) scheme, in which mobile agents are dispatched to collect and analyze deadlock information distributed across the network sites and, based on the analysis, to detect and resolve deadlocks. Then the design of an adaptive hybrid algorithm derived from the framework is presented. The algorithm can dynamically adapt itself to the changes in system state by using different deadlock detec- tion strategies. The performance of the proposed algorithm has been evaluated using simulations. The results show that the algorithm can outperform existing algorithms that use a fixed deadlock detection strategy. Mobile agent has shown its promise as a powerful means to complement and enhance existing technology in various application areas. In particular, existing work has demonstrated that MA can simplify the development and improve the performance of certain classes of distributed applications, especially for those running on a wide-area, heterogeneous, and dynamic networking environment like the Internet. In our previous work, we extended the application of MA to the design of distributed control functions, which require the maintenance of logical relationship among and / or coordination of proc- essing entities in a distributed system. A novel framework is presented for structuring and building distributed systems, which use cooperating mobile agents as an aid to carry out coordination and cooperation tasks in distributed systems. The framework has been used for designing various distributed control functions such as load balancing and mutual ex- clusion in our previous work. In this paper, we use the framework to propose a novel ap- proach to detecting deadlocks in distributed system by using mobile agents, which dem- onstrates the advantage of being adaptive and flexible of mobile agents. We first describe the MAEDD (Mobile Agent Enabled Deadlock Detection) scheme , in which mobile agents are dispatched to collect and analyze deadlock information distributed across the network sites and, based on the analysis, to detect and resolve deadlocks. Then the design of an adaptive hybrid algorithm derived from the framework is presented. adapt itself to the changes in system state by using different deadlock detec- tion strategies. The performance of the proposed algorithm has been evaluated using simulations. The results show that the algorithm can outperform existing algorithms that use a fixed deadlock detection strategy.
其他文献
一宋代酿酒业的兴盛两宋是我国古代政治、经济、文化大发展的时期。特别是唐中叶以来至宋初,开始形成了以专卖法为中心的税制和财政制度,为了增加财政收入,宋朝自始至终实行
随着新课标的全面推行,小学语文的阅读教学也面临着改革创新的问题,如何通过激发学生文本阅读兴趣来提高语文阅读的教学质量,也成了当前小学语文老师急需解决的问题,本文就是在此基础上,对小学语文教学激发文本阅读兴趣的有效方法展开论述。  【關键词】小学语文;文本阅读兴趣;有效方法  当前小学语文阅读教学中还存在诸多问题,如语文老师在课堂上盲目拓展教材内容以及没有重视学生的主体地位等,这些问题不仅降低语文阅
7月13日至14日,党中央、国务院召开了新世纪以来第一次全国教育工作会议,这是我国教育事业改革发展一个新的里程碑。胡锦涛总书记和温家宝总理在会上作了重要讲话,深刻总结了
履带式装甲车的电传动技术已获得了巨大进步,但目前的纯电传动还显现出操控,特别是转向性能方面的不足。由此看来,单纯地采用电传动的话,其体积、重量、成本和风险都显得太大
侦察炮弹是一种通过摄像机、传感器等电子设备,对目标进行侦察、探测的信息化炮弹。就目前研制情况来看,它主要包括电视侦察炮弹、视频成像侦察炮弹、传感侦察炮弹和红外侦察
2011年夏初,湖北省襄阳市邮政局面对全市金融业务市场余额发展的瓶颈期,主动打破淡旺季经营的惯性思维,充分抓住“三夏”(夏粮、夏果、夏油)等农副产品资金回笼的有利时机,以
Based on a proposed Web service-based grid architecture, a service grid middleware system called CROWN is designed in this paper. As the two kernel points of th
新修订的“义务教育课程标准”(以下简称《标准》),坚持了教育改革的大方向。第一,表述更加准确、规范、明了、全面,更适合教材编写、教师教学、学习评价等;第二,内容上做了
S-200是苏联于上世纪五、六十年代为对付XB-70超音速战略轰炸机和SR-71超音速侦察机而发展出的一种远程中高空防空导弹系统,北约称之为SA-5“甘蒙” The S-200 was a long-r
Background &Aims: Studies in health have shown that tension sensitive mechanoreceptors mediate sensitivity to gastric distention. A role for these mechanorecept